ETYMOLOGY OF THE WORD CLAMOUR

From Old French clamour, from Latin clāmor, from clāmāre to cry out.

WHAT DOES CLAMOUR M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Definition of clamour in the English dictionary

The first definition of clamour in the dictionary is a loud persistent outcry, as from a large number of people. Other definition of clamour is a vehement expression of collective feeling or outrage. Clamour is also a loud and persistent noise.
